God Bless Evan and his memory. Thank you Dana and wow for candidly speaking about Evan’s story. There were two suicides in my son’s graduating class 2 boys out of 200 students died in such a way as well. 2 families faced the same grief as Dana.
People with bipolar, like myself feel and see the world amplified at times and the trials and tribulations of life magnified can become seemingly unbearable. Only now with some distance on my last episode can I see that these emotions pass with time.
There are at least six different types of bipolar disorder listed in the DSMIV and a wide array of treatments. I imagine it makes this very difficult to pinpoint how to help people like me, like Evan, like others and while I acknowledge the good intentions of psychiatry it often falls short in achieving its goals. Just my opinion after reading bipolar boards online and seeing my peers functioning well below their intellect. The diagnosis carries the idea that one could be some sort of killer, stalker, hateful sort of person. The reputation of having bipolar is akin to putting a person in a cage, one might become even be scared of themselves due to negative reports about people who may or may not have had the illness. It’s scary to be told that you’re bipolar.
I am certainly sad that Evan is not with his mother. It is not her fault.
God Bless Dana and her family…thank you for sharing a most difficult story.
